Germany, Luftwaffe. A Mint Observer’s Badge, By Gebrüder Wegerhoff United Republic of 5 mm (h) tie clip(Beobachterabzeichen). Constructed of silvered tombak, the obverse consisting of an oval laurel and oak leaf wreath joined together at the bottom by ribbon, overlaid by a swooping Luftwaffe eagle clutching a mobile swastika, the reverse with two visible rivets securing the obverse eagle in place, with a narrow barrel hinge and vertical pinback meeting a flat wire catch, maker marked with the logo of Gebrder Wegerhoff, Ldenscheid, measuring 52. 54 mm
